Saudi Arabia has recently announced the development of an $٨٥٣ million residential project in the Expo ٢٠٣٠ village in Riyadh. This project includes ٢,٣٠٠ apartment units that can accommodate ٥,٥٠٠ people. The plan is designed to host ٤٢ million visitors at the Expo ٢٠٣٠ World Exhibition.
Details of the Residential Project
The Expo ٢٠٣٠ village project will include modern residential units and various recreational facilities. These units are designed to meet the diverse needs of residents and provide a comfortable and optimal living environment. Additionally, this project will contribute to achieving Saudi Arabia's sustainable development goals and will be presented as a model in design and construction in the country.
Economic Implications
This project is part of Saudi Arabia's macro plans to increase investment in the urban and economic infrastructure of the country. Given that the Expo ٢٠٣٠ World Exhibition is considered an important international event, this project could create new job opportunities and contribute to the economic growth of the region. Furthermore, this initiative will also help attract foreign and domestic investors for other developmental projects in Saudi Arabia.
Considering the high importance of Expo ٢٠٣٠ and the need for suitable infrastructure to host a large number of visitors, the development of this project is viewed as a positive step towards achieving Saudi Arabia's economic and social goals. It is expected that this project will strengthen Riyadh's position as an international destination and attract more tourists and investors.
